We are seeking a Head of Project Management Office (PMO) to join the Information Technology Directorate at the Maritime Coastguard Agency (MCA) is responsible for delivering digital solutions that support the agency’s operations. The PMO plays a pivotal role in ensuring consistent, high-quality project delivery across the IT portfolio. Led by the Head of IT Delivery Management, the Project Management Office team provides leadership, integration, and oversight of project processes, resource management, and financial reporting. The PMO supports delivery teams with best practice guidance, training, and tools like Planview PPM and MS Project enabling efficient tracking and performance improvement.

As the Head of IT PMO, you will lead the function, driving consistency and excellence across the IT Directorate’s project delivery. The role oversees project planning, governance, resource management, and financial reporting, while embedding best practice methodologies. Acting as a strategic enabler, the postholder empowers teams through training and advice, ensuring tools and processes are in place to support successful delivery across multiple interrelated projects, programmes, and portfolios.
Your responsibilities will include, but aren’t limited to:
- Lead and evolve the IT PMO function, ensuring continuous improvement and operational excellence.
- Manage daily PMO activities, tools, and methodologies to support consistent project delivery.
- Develop and implement strategic plans to enhance PMO capability and influence across IT.
- Own MCA’s project delivery methodology and ensure alignment with organisational objectives.
- Provide expert training and guidance to IT teams on tools, processes, and best practices.
- Oversee resource planning, governance, and performance reporting across the IT portfolio.
- Ensure robust project planning, risk and issue management, and benefit tracking.
- Lead the PMO team and contribute to the wider IT Directorate’s success and delivery goals.
